4 New Takes on The New Neutral
4 New Takes on the New Neutral
Enter into the new decade in new-tral style!

When someone says “neutrals,” what colors immediately come to mind? For many of us, we jump to black and different shades of brown. Those are, and always will be classic neutrals. They are safe, easy to layer, and feel comfortable throughout the inclement weather and frigid temperatures that the winter months bring us. But, while these neutrals will always be timeless, there is another palette that absolutely can and should be part of your cold-weather “neutral zone”: white, cream, grey, and silver. This palette brings a fresh lift to 2020 and the sometimes “heavy” neutrals in our closets and can work particularly well during the festive season (which for some of us is still going!).






I love this clean, bright base for so many looks right now, whether you are attending a dressy post-holiday get together, a charity luncheon for your business, or just want a fresh update on your everyday look. And, NO, I am not suggesting you wear all winter whites in a slushy mess! Choose to experiment with this new palette on those days when the weather cooperates. These colors – combined or on their own – can feel just as classic and stylish (and perhaps a bit more soft and luxurious) as our darker neutral palette.
Here are a few ideas to rock these classics in a fresh, neutral way in 2020
The New Neutrals
Color Trend: White
Confident, classic, clean, and unexpectedly bold. White instantly feels chic, elevated, smart, and even a little bit intimidating (in a good way). Wear this neutral from head-to-toe or as a clean basic. Check out this Nili Lotan cashmere sweater. I see it paired with coordinating wide-leg wool pants, or light grey jeans.
Color Trend: Cream
White’s softer-spoken sister, cream evokes feelings of cozy fireplaces and cocoa. Don’t let this color fool you; it makes an incredible neutral because it flows easily with so many looks and palettes and isn’t as “look at me” as it’s brighter sister. For 2020, look for inspiration in this classic, this monochromatic look – stunning.
Color Trend: Grey
Blondes, brunettes, redheads, and silver-haired beauties delight. Grey is a shade that just plain works for so many skin types and hair colors. Pantone’s Ash, a cool-toned gray, was chosen as one of its eight spring 2020 color classics, refer to as ‘solid and strong.” Darker and stronger or lighter and softer, grey looks incredible when paired with a bright (or soft) white and feels effortlessly chic. Check out this gorgeous wrap – You might just want to wrap yourself in it. Throw in a silver belt or heels, and you will be ready for an evening out in Vail or a cozy dinner in with family.
Color Trend: Silver
the metallic in your 2020 neutral palette is a classic silver. Silver is a fresh take on the gold we’re seeing everywhere (don’t worry I still love gold!) and pulls this new neutral collection together, giving it a little excitement, a little edge. Work silver into your belt, shoes, bag, or even hair accessory and watch this neutral collection come together.

3 Savvy Tips for Buying a Luxury Handbag (from a Seasoned Pro)
Buying a designer bag can be an emotional experience, from the thrill and excitement of the purchase to the stress of the price. Let these three tips help guide you in your search for a high-end handbag that you'll love and use for a lifetime.

The time has come. Perhaps, you have been carefully saving any extra cash for the past year. Or maybe a loved one has surprised you this holiday with a generous gift card. Regardless of the scenario, you finally have the funds to purchase a new luxury handbag. So … now what do you do?!
Choosing a luxury handbag can be one of the most exciting and memorable experiences – a big first for many of us! Investing in a piece that you will have for the rest of your life (and can hand down to your little girl) can make you feel like a queen, inside and out. But, when the time comes to walk into your store of choice and make this both fashionable and financial decision, it can be scary, nerve-wracking, and overwhelming. With so many amazing brands, styles, materials, and colors, it can feel like you are being set up to make the wrong decision. And, let’s be honest – there is nothing worse than getting home, opening your shopping bag, and feeling like you made a panicked choice (especially when most high-end designers don’t accept returns). So, as a means to lessen your shopping jitters, I have compiled a few essential tips to keep in mind before you hand over your AMEX. After reading through these pointers, developed from my personal experiences, you’ll learn how to choose the one essential piece every handbag collection needs: the clutch.



Buy for YOUR Brand
In so many of the pieces I have written, I have emphasized the importance of knowing your individual style. And in the circumstance of choosing a luxury designer bag, you must stay true to your distinct style soul. That’s why going shopping with friends can be dangerous, as its inevitable your tastes will have some sort of variance. So, choose a designer that aligns with your “brand.” Classic and Conservative? Try Chanel, Celine, and Dior. A little dark and edgy? I love Givenchy, Saint Laurent, and Balenciaga. A little bit of both? Have a look in Louis Vuitton, Prada, and Gucci. Know who you are before you start this process. Even if it’s the designer of the moment or the bag, all your friends have, eliminate the brands that don’t fit with your everyday style.
Fun, but Functional
I remember I came home with this super eclectic, bright, and bold Prada bag one day. I was so excited about it; it was my first piece from that brand, and it was a head-turning, show-stopping knockout. But, when I proudly showed my husband, he sweetly looked at me as if not to crush my heart and said: “where are you going to wear that?” Ugh. He was right. I had purchased an “exotic” – an original, one-time release bag that I would probably wear … one time. The lesson I learned here was that while designer bags may stand out on a shelf because they are distinctive, it doesn’t mean they are practical. Choose a bag that you can wear at any point in the day – to your child’s school play AND your charity’s luncheon AND on a date night with your man. That may mean staying with a solid color or smart shape, but it doesn’t mean it’s not special. It means you will use it!



Rise to Your Location
Where you live can have an impact on so many parts of your wardrobe, and your new bag will be one of them. Cold-weathered locations will bring on darker, neutral colors, particularly in fall and winter. If you’re continually dealing with snow and sleet, a white or light-colored bag just doesn’t make sense. And while black or brown may feel like a seasonal (cold weather) pick, they are both colors that can totally be worn throughout every season. The same goes for a Floridian. With shorts and sandals basically being year-round attire, they can get away with creams, beige, even soft pastels. So, when choosing, work with where you live and keep in mind that may place some limitations on an all-season bag.
